A Ritual Spirit prep new single release – “Revolutionary” coming soon
Following the release of highly praised mini-album Elements I [our review here - Mosh] last year, A Ritual Spirit will put out stand-alone single "Revolutionary" on Friday 6th October 2023 produced by Jamie Gilchrist (King Witch), followed a week later by a video for the track directed by ex-Exploited guitarist Robbie Davidson.
